This lovely pendant is made in 18kt yellow gold. It was perfectly handcrafted and it represents the profile of the famous Egyptian queen Cleopatra. On the verso, we can clearly see the cartouche of the queen. A cartouche is an oval with a horizontal line at one end, indicating that the text enclosed is a royal name. It was made at the end of the 20th century. Cleopatra is easily recognizable : she is wearing the Egyptian crown and a snake is surrounding her. The legend said that she was bitten by a snake after she’s heard her lover, Marc Antoine, died.The medal weighs 4,5gr and it measures 27,9 (1) x 19,9 (0,78) mm. The bottom of the front is a bit used, we can still see some papyrus’ flower.The hinge is marked with the eagle’s head and with the maker’s mark R / a symbol (?) / G.
